Hello and welcome to the forum!

I got bad shoulder pain with Simvastatin but it disappeared with Atorvastatin, and I know people where the reverse was true and this may apply to you. You need to speak to your GP as Yogi1950s suggests.

You should only take calcium supplements under medical guidance! Your bio says nothing but if you have narrowed/calcified arteries logic says this might not be an appropriate move.

It seems to me you need to discuss all of this with your GP. If for instance it is lower back pain exercises to improve your core strength might be more appropriate!
